2023-08-08cmd/internal/obj/mips: add SEB/SEH instructionsJunxian Zhu
Add support for SEB/SEH instructions, which are introduced in mips32r2. SEB/SEH can be used to sign-extend byte/halfword in registers directly without passing through memory. 2023-08-03cmd/internal/obj/mips: add WSBH/DSBH/DSHD instructionsJunxian Zhu
Add support for WSBH/DSBH/DSHD instructions, which are introduced in mips{32,64}r2. WSBH reverse bytes within halfwords for 32-bit word, DSBH reverse bytes within halfwords for 64-bit doubleword, and DSHD reverse halfwords within doublewords. These instructions can be used to optimize byte swaps. 2020-05-06cmd/internal/obj, runtime: preempt & restart some instruction sequencesCherry Zhang
On some architectures, for async preemption the injected call needs to clobber a register (usually REGTMP) in order to return to the preempted function. As a consequence, the PC ranges where REGTMP is live are not preemptible. The uses of REGTMP are usually generated by the assembler, where it needs to load or materialize a large constant or offset that doesn't fit into the instruction. In those cases, REGTMP is not live at the start of the instruction sequence. Instead of giving up preemption in those cases, we could preempt it and restart the sequence when resuming the execution. Basically, this is like reissuing an interrupted instruction, except that here the "instruction" is a Prog that consists of multiple machine instructions. For this to work, we need to generate PC data to mark the start of the Prog. Currently this is only done for ARM64. TODO: the split-stack function prologue is currently not async preemptible. We could use this mechanism, preempt it and restart at the function entry. 2020-04-03cmd/internal/obj/mips: don't emit spurious CALLIND relocationsCherry Zhang
Generate a CALLIND relocation only for indirect calls, not for indirect jumps. In particular, the RET instruction is lowered to JMP (LR), an indirect jump, and occurs frequently. The large amount of spurious relocations causes the linker to do a lot of extra work. 2019-11-07cmd/internal/obj/mips: mark unsafe pointsCherry Zhang
For async preemption, we will be using REGTMP as a temporary register in injected call on MIPS, which will clobber it. So any code that uses REGTMP is not safe for async preemption. In the assembler backend, we expand a Prog to multiple machine instructions and use REGTMP as a temporary register if necessary. These need to be marked unsafe. In fact, most of the multi-instruction Progs use REGTMP, so we mark all of them, except ones that are whitelisted. 2019-10-29cmd/internal/obj/mips: fix encoding of FCR registersCherry Zhang
The asm encoder generally assumes that the lowest 5 bits of the REG_XX constants match the machine instruction encoding, i.e. the lowest 5 bits is the register number. This was not true for FCR registers and M registers. Make it so. MOV Rx, FCRy was encoded as two machine instructions. The first is unnecessary. Remove. 2017-10-11cmd/compile: abort earlier if stack frame too largeKeith Randall
If the stack frame is too large, abort immediately. We used to generate code first, then abort. In issue 22200, generating code raised a panic so we got an ICE instead of an error message. Change the max frame size to 1GB (from 2GB). Stack frames between 1.1GB and 2GB didn't used to work anyway, the pcln table generation would have failed and generated an ICE. 2017-08-02cmd/compile: set/unset base register for better assembly printCherry Zhang
For address of an auto or arg, on all non-x86 architectures the assembler backend encodes the actual SP offset in the instruction but leaves the offset in Prog unchanged. When the assembly is printed in compile -S, it shows an offset relative to pseudo FP/SP with an actual hardware SP base register (e.g. R13 on ARM). This is confusing. Unset the base register if it is indeed SP, so the assembly output is consistent. If the base register isn't SP, it should be an error and the error output contains the actual base register. For address loading instructions, the base register isn't set in the compiler on non-x86 architectures. Set it. Normally it is SP and will be unset in the change mentioned above for printing. If it is not, it will be an error and the error output contains the actual base register. No change in generated binary, only printed assembly. Passes "go build -a -toolexec 'toolstash -cmp' std cmd" on all architectures. Fixes #21064. 2017-04-06cmd/compile: teach assemblers to accept a Prog allocatorJosh Bleecher Snyder
The existing bulk Prog allocator is not concurrency-safe. To allow for concurrency-safe bulk allocation of Progs, I want to move Prog allocation and caching upstream, to the clients of cmd/internal/obj. This is a preliminary enabling refactoring. After this CL, instead of calling Ctxt.NewProg throughout the assemblers, we thread through a newprog function that returns a new Prog. That function is set up to be Ctxt.NewProg, so there are no real changes in this CL; this CL only establishes the plumbing. Passes toolstash-check -all. Negligible compiler performance impact.
